Gwyneth Paltrow and Chris Martin are holidaying on Faith Hill and Tim Mcgraw's private island.

The former couple - who announced last week they were ending their 10-year marriage - flew from Eleuthera in the Bahamas, where they have been vacationing since news of their split broke, to nearby Goat Cay with their children Apple, nine. and Moses, seven, by private plane on Sunday (30.03.14).

A source who saw the pair boarding their plane told MailOnline: ''They looked happy and calm. Chris was wearing a hat and Gwyneth was casual in a white t-shirt...they drove right up to their private jet with the kids in tow.''

The plane took off around 9.50am and landed in Cave Cay, a private islet where commercial aircraft are banned, and were met by an ''entourage of staff'' before boarding a private boat to take them to the 17-acre island which their friends - who they bonded with when Gwyneth and Tim made 'Country Strong' together in 2010 - have owned since 2008.

The island boasts a 15,000-square-foot, four-bedroom house that comes complete with a lookout tower, as well as three smaller houses for their staff.

Despite their separation, the Coldplay frontman and the 'Iron Man 3' star have pledged to stay friends for the sake of their kids and appeared closer than ever on their holiday last week.

An onlooker in a restaurant where the pair were dining said: ''Chris was making Gwyneth laugh until she had to wipe tears from her eyes.

''You wouldn't believe they were divorcing. They were deep in conversation and looked really happy together.''
